Ron Date: 09/25/16 18:34 Re: BN E9 units at Aurora,Il -- June 91 Author: chitownjeff I believe every Metra line has one train with two engines, I've heard they are called protection engines, so If one of the engines craps out at a outlying terminal they just take one of the engines off the double headed train and place it on the crippled train.
